Duct sections can disconnect at joints and connections from the thermal cycling that expands and contracts the ductwork with every HVAC cycle, from vibration during operation, from settling of the home structure, and from pest activity in Magalia, CA. A disconnected duct section delivers conditioned air to wherever the disconnection opens rather than to the register it was serving in Magalia. In an attic, that means heating or cooling the attic space in Magalia, CA. In a crawl space, it means conditioning the crawl space rather than the room above it in Magalia. Disconnected duct sections are one of the most common and most impactful ductwork faults and one of the most straightforward to repair when found in Magalia, CA.
Flexible duct is the most common duct material in residential systems because of its ease of installation and flexibility for routing in tight spaces in Magalia. It is also the most vulnerable to physical damage in Magalia, CA. Pests gnaw through flexible duct outer jackets and inner liner layers. Physical contact from people working in attics and crawl spaces tears the liner. And flexible duct that has been kinked or run at too sharp an angle collapses at that point, partially or fully blocking airflow in Magalia. A disconnected supply duct in an unconditioned attic in summer is delivering 55-degree air into a space that may be 130 degrees in Magalia. The delivered conditioned air instantly mixes with the attic air and has no benefit for the home's occupants in Magalia, CA. The HVAC system runs continuously trying to cool a living space that is receiving reduced airflow because the disconnected duct is diverting supply air to the attic in Magalia. Reconnecting the duct delivers that supply air to the room instead in Magalia, CA.
Return duct leaks in crawl spaces draw unconditioned crawl space air including moisture and any contamination in the crawl space environment into the return airstream in Magalia, CA. This unconditioned air bypasses the filter and enters the air handler directly in Magalia. The result is elevated indoor humidity, potential mold growth in the air handler from the excess moisture, and introduction of crawl space contamination into the circulated air in Magalia, CA.

Pressure testing applies a measured pressure to the duct system and measures the rate of pressure loss in Magalia. The pressure loss rate quantifies the total leakage in the system and provides a baseline for comparing before and after repair performance in Magalia, CA. Where pressure testing identifies significant leakage beyond what visual inspection accounts for, additional investigation locates the hidden leaks in Magalia.
ISA Air Duct measures airflow from each supply register to identify rooms receiving less than their designed airflow volume in Magalia, CA. Low airflow at a specific register points to a duct fault in the run serving that register in Magalia. Systematically measuring airflow at every register provides a complete picture of the duct system's delivery performance in Magalia, CA.
Thermal imaging reveals temperature differentials in walls, floors, and ceilings that indicate conditioned air leaking into building cavities from duct connections and joints in Magalia. Where pressure testing and airflow measurement indicate significant duct leakage that visual inspection has not located, thermal imaging helps identify the specific leak locations in Magalia, CA.

Torn, collapsed, or pest-damaged flexible duct sections are removed and replaced with correctly specified new flexible duct in Magalia. Replacement sections are installed with correct minimum radius bends that prevent kinking, correct support spacing that prevents sagging, and correct connection and sealing at both ends in Magalia, CA.
Leaking duct joints and seams are sealed using the correct materials for the specific duct type and location in Magalia, CA. Mastic duct sealant for joints that require durable, flexible sealing that maintains adhesion through thermal cycling in Magalia. UL 181-rated foil tape for sheet metal seams that require clean, smooth sealing in Magalia, CA. Never standard duct tape which fails within a few seasons from temperature cycling and UV exposure in Magalia.
